Symptom
- Self-Reflexive Partner Function Not Overwriten in C4C to S/4HANA Cloud Business Partner Replication
Environment
SAP S/4HANA Cloud
Reproducing the Issue
- A non-reflexive partner function is sent from C4C to S/4HANA Cloud via a webservice message e.g. SH 1234567 is sent to Customer 7654321
- The new partner function is added instead of overwriting the existing partner function e.g. SH 1234567 is added to the Customer 7654321 instead of replacing the SH 7654321
Cause
There is no way to overwrite an existing self-reflexive Partner Function with a new one when sending data from C4C to S/4HANA Cloud. The reason for this is that C4C does not support self reflexive partner functions and as such there is special coding in S/4HC which add the self-reflexive partner functions when a message is recieved from C4C, as such the new partner function is added in addition rather than as a replacement.
Resolution
Standard system behaviour
Keywords
Self-Reflexive, Partner Functions, Overwrite, Self-Reflexive Partner Functions , KBA , LO-MD-BP-WS , Web Service for Business Partner , How To
Product
SAP S/4HANA Cloud all versions